Good analysis Keenan, A&M has one of the best backcourts in the country, Taylor was 1st team SEC last year and pre-season SEC POY this year, he loves to get to the basket off the dribble and gets to the line a lot and shoots almost 90% fts, he is an outstanding player. The other guard Radford is tough as nails, averaged almost 6 rebs per game last year in the SEC from the guard position, very impressive and had 21 pts & 7 rebs in their last game a road win at SMU. The Eagles have to keep these 2 out of the paint and can't allow them to get to the rim or it will be a very long night, probably see some zone against them, better to force them into jumpers then getting to the basket for easy buckets. A&M overall plays very aggressive D and pounds the glass. Could very easily be an elite 8 or final 4 team. The Golden Eagles have to play with intensity, a win is probably unlikely, but I hope we play hard. We can't let them push our offense out from where we want to run it and can be effective. We have to get a body on all 5 players on the floor and box out when a shot goes up, they will all be coming aggressively. Our bigs have to play hard without fouling- particularly Jones, we need his big body tonight on the glass not on the bench with foul trouble.
